Heavenly Productions Foundation donated 100 teddy bears to Maria Fareri Children's Hospital in Valhalla.
Each of these stuffed animals were given to babies and children battling cancer or other illnesses.
Heavenly Productions is a nonprofit organization that helps children in need worldwide.
